Transaction 7463ced08a676efd1d8cbbb1ff1954757f3ff60edbfee4f2addfe16af2cd95e9

block
ba01a43aa5ce2b1e8bea8a120f598aad18771b93f05e4b7161cfaa189a9f525a

34 Inputs

2 Outputs